Design and Performance Evaluation of Efficient Consensus Protocols for Mobile Ad Hoc Networks

It is now well recognised that the consensus problem is a fundamental problem when one has to implement fault-tolerant distributed services. In this paper, we extend the consensusparadigm to asynchronous distributed mobile systems prone to disconnection and process crash failures. The paper, first, shows that a consensus problem between mobile hosts is reducible to two agreement problems (a consensus problem and a group membership problem) between fixed hosts. Then, following an approach investigated by Guerraoui and Schiper, the paper uses a generic consensus service as a basic building block to construct a modular and simple solution.
